65.07 Power of council to levy taxes.
(1)The common council shall have power to levy annually a tax upon all the taxable property in the city for the following purposes:
(a)A sufficient general city fund to pay the expenses of city departments, boards and commissions which are subject to the control of the common council. The rate of taxation for the purposes enumerated in this paragraph shall be established only by affirmative vote of at least two-thirds of all members elected to the common council.
(b)A fund to pay the city’s contribution to the fire fighters’ and police officers’ pension fund and for any similar fund which may be created by law.
(c)A sufficient permanent improvement fund for any purpose authorized by s. 66.0913
(1), 67.04 or 67.12 for which money may be borrowed or bonds issued, and for the initial furniture, fixtures, machinery and equipment required in such new facilities permitted thereunder.
